Maurice Colbourne (24 September 1939 â€" 4 August 1989) was an English
stage and television actor who starred as Tom Howard in the BBC
television series Howards' Way. He is also known for roles in other
television series such as Gangsters, The Onedin Line, The Day of the
Triffids and Doctor Who. He was usually cast as a villain in his
career.Maurice Colbourne was born Roger Middleton in Sheffield, three
weeks after Britain and France declared war on Germany upon the
outbreak of the Second World War, and studied acting at the Central
School of Speech and Drama. He took his stage name from that of an
earlier film actor called Maurice Colbourne, (24 September 1894â€"22
September 1965), who shared the same birthday (in a different year) as
his.
